I’ve taken the time to purchase and upgrade my current system whilst in locked down in the UK:banghead: : Purchasing the recommended equipment from the ™-website. I followed the instructions as per normal downloading appropriate Catalina Mac OS 10.15.4 using UniBeast 10.1.0 created a boot drive USB installer. Adjusted the BIOS ensuring the correct settings are made. Start the boot process and I am getting stuck at the following (see png file)

Hardware

ASUS ROG MAXIMUS HERO IV
Latest Bios | Asus Radeon RX 580 ROG STRIX OC 8GB Graphics Card Core i9-9900K Corsair H60 (Water) | Crucial Ballistix Sport LT (32GB) Corsair CX750 Power supply.

Unibeast 10.1.0 Clover 5107 added the ACPI patches in the clover EFI, run add SSDT-EC.aml and other patches running app to SSDTTimes app has shown in 1689 searches (attached files)

Now I got a fully working system. I haven't built a hackintosh in a long time. So I forgot that I had to mount the EFI partition, I was putting the .aml files in the EFI-BACKUP folder. For me it worked by placing 03 files in the Volume / EFI / CLOVER / ACPI / patched. What I understood was that these files are important for all motherboards with intel kabylakes processors.

Right after making the pen drive with Unibeast the UFI partition showoff. Later I also had to put these same files on the EFI partition in the NVMe where Catalina was installed.
